Intellian has received Inmarsat Type Approval for its latest innovation, the GX100NX antenna, which is now authorised for use on the Global Xpress satellite network and Inmarsat Fleet Xpress service.

This development marks a significant step for Intellian in enhancing maritime satellite communications, as the GX100NX is set to unlock the full capabilities of Fleet Xpress, a rapidly expanding Maritime VSAT service. Introduced in May 2019, the GX100NX aims to provide maritime users with superior RF performance, supported by a 10W high power BUC option to ensure robust Ka-band connectivity.

Advanced Satellite Solutions

The GX100NX joins Intellian's growing NX series, noted for its faster, lighter, and more durable antennas that offer excellent performance across major satellite networks. The GX100NX incorporates a single cable design, coupled with the new AptusNX software, both of which facilitate quick installation and maintenance.

This focus on simplifying deployment results in cost efficiencies without compromising on link performance. Additionally, the NX platform's modular design contributes to reduced spare part inventory requirements by up to 40%.

Enhancing cost-effectiveness, the GX100NX Below Deck Unit consolidates the Antenna Control Unit, GX modem, and mediator function for dual antenna configurations within a single unit, thus further cutting down on installation and commissioning time and expenses.
